St Michael’s Veterans Center, Kansas City, Missouri, Phase I
New Construction of Multi-Family Housing
(Permanent Housing for Homeless and Disabled Veterans) 55,158 sq. ft., $7.6M, 58 Units Completed 2014 Multi-family Category - Capstone Award Winner- 2015 KC-EDC - Cornerstone Award for Community Development, 2015 Developed through a partnership between Catholic Charities of Kansas City – St. Joseph and Yarco Co. and designed by Rosemann & Associates P.C., the 58-unit apartment complex offers permanent housing options for at-risk veterans. The complex is complete with a vast amount of amenities including; social services, a computer lab, library, an exercise room, laundry facilities on each floor, community and meeting space and support service offices. A unique challenge faced by the construction team was due to the financing date being pushed back several times while contractual deadlines stood firm. 4Sight was faced with an accelerated schedule that caused an uncomfortable need to push the project harder than originally scheduled. Through focused cooperation from subcontractors and suppliers, 4Sight accelerated the project to completion on time and on budget. This project has received numerous regional accolades. St Michael’s Veterans Center, Kansas City, Missouri- Phase IINew Construction of Multi-Family Housing (Permanent Housing for Homeless and Disabled Veterans) 67,000 sq. ft., 59 Units, Construction will begin in the fall of 2015.St Michael’s Veterans Center, Kansas City, Missouri- "Honor Pavilion"Commemorative Garden to connect all the branches of the military; Army, Navy, Air Force Marines, and National Guard. Different colored flowers represent the different branches of the military. Construction will begin in the fall of 2015. |
